Sawicki on Reckonings:

If This Process Continues to Drag On, the Coalition Will Lose the Election.

Mateusz Nowak

- It doesn't really matter at all. Please realize that we are more than two years after the parliamentary elections, that Zbigniew Ziobro has waited two years for his immunity to be revoked and for approval for his arrest, and there is less than 1.5 years left to settle this process - Marek Sawicki said on RMF24, when asked if he thought an arrest warrant would be issued concerning Ziobro.

- Today, PiS MPs, PiS politicians, know perfectly well and are waiting for the next elections. If this process of reckonings continues to drag on as it is, then of course the current coalition of October 15 will lose these elections, and the new-old prosecutor Zbigniew Ziobro will simply revoke all the prosecution's requests directed either to the Sejm or to the court - he continued.

- This process [of reckonings] has not really begun in effect. A few requests, a few indictments, a few immunities – where are the indictments in court concerning the most important matters? We have been talking for so long about issues related to ventilators, we have been talking for so long about matters related to the Fundusz Sprawiedliwości (Justice Fund); besides Romanowski, who else faces indictments? Which court, at least in the first instance, has issued a ruling? - he went on to say.

- Another court has already revoked the European arrest warrant for Mr. Romanowski, so it is clear that in the justice system, after 10 years of Zbigniew Ziobro's rampant influence, it turns out that both prosecutors and judges are more loyal to their principal than to the law and the Republic - he added.
